I just received my TLR-1 and noticed the red tag in the battery bay.It said to use several brands of CR123A batteries,but Surefire were NOT on the list.I assume that this is because of being their competion.The Streamlight batteries that came with it,and the Surefire that I already have are both lithium.The warning says that the light will either explode or catch fire if unapproved batteries are used.I am quite sure this is B.S.,but was curious if anyone has used Surefire's in a Streamlight.Thanks.
